G'day, I have mentioned in the past that I have noticed, fairly frequently, that sometimes when first powering up my K3 the received audio sounds weak. This evening I was listening to a 20M QSO between an LU and an LA, both S9. I had the distinct notion that for the af gain setting the audio was not as loud as I would normally expect.
When this happens I usually turn the K3 off wait a second or three and turn it back on. When I did this the audio output (phones) was hugely increased, no measurements unfortunately but at least +6dB. Given that a power cycle sorts out the problem I'm wondering if there isn't some sort of initialisation problem, something like the logic races of old. I'm not using any extreme agc settings, virtually default numbers. The house is quiet, my ears still work, and I usually use phones and seldom have the af gain (LO) more than 10 o'clock. Has anyone else noticed this?
